The latest edition of Friday Night SmackDown was stacked with some huge matches and segment. It has been noted that before SmackDown went live, there was a non-televised match in front of the live audience, featuring Ashante ‘Thee’ Adonis and Cameron Grimes. Interestingly, B-Fab accompanied Adonis, and she made a reference to Top Dolla, as reported by fans who were in attendance and shared their observations on social media. In the end, it was Cameron Grimes who emerged as the victor in this match.

 


 

WWE recently had the first round of talent releases after completing their merger with UFC under TKO Group Holdings earlier this month. The two combat sports giants officially completed their merger on September 12. The new entity known as TKO Group Holdings made its stock market debut soon after at the New York Stock Exchange.

The merger lead to mass layoffs only days after.  It has been noted that the layoffs didn’t stop with office employees only. As expected, the promotion has begun laying off some of the on-screen talents as well.
